What is the definition of dramatic irony?

English
1 answer:
andrew11 [14]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

B. A situation where the audience knows more about what will happen in a story than the main character

In own his blindness the speaker refers to a luminous mist that surrounds me unvarying that breaks things down into a single thi
Dafna11 [192]

Answer:

The author in "On his blindness" refers to his blindness.

Explanation:

Jorge Luis Borges, the author of this poem, suffered from blindness and that is what he reflects in this poem.

What he means when he says "it breaks things down into a single thing, colorless, formless" is how he sees things because of blindness, as formless and colorless things.

This poem has a melancholic tone. The blindness that came to Borges in 1955 meant a great change for him, since he was a lover and fond of reading.
